需求收集例子怎么写好

需求收集例子怎么写好

在撰写需求收集例子的过程中,详细记录需求、明确需求优先级、使用有效的沟通工具、创建需求管理文档、定期更新需求状态是至关重要的。其中,详细记录需求尤为关键。详细记录需求不仅可以确保每个需求的细节都被充分考虑,还可以避免在项目进行过程中出现理解偏差,从而提高项目的成功率。


一、详细记录需求

详细记录需求是需求收集的基础步骤之一。无论是通过会议、邮件还是调查问卷收集到的需求,都需要进行详细的记录。这不仅包括需求的内容,还应包括需求的来源、提出时间、相关背景信息等。详细记录需求能够帮助团队成员在后续的工作中更好地理解和实施这些需求。

例如,当客户提出一个新的功能需求时,团队应该记录下这个功能的具体实现方式、预期效果以及优先级。同时,还要记录提出需求的客户姓名、联系方式、提出时间和需求背景。这样做不仅能帮助团队在后续的开发过程中参考和追溯,还能提高客户满意度。

二、明确需求优先级

在收集需求的过程中,明确需求的优先级是至关重要的。并不是所有的需求都同等重要,有些需求可能对项目的成功至关重要,而有些则可能是次要的甚至是可选的。因此,团队需要根据项目的目标和资源情况,合理地安排需求的优先级。

优先级的确定可以通过与客户沟通、团队内部讨论以及根据项目目标进行判断。例如,某些功能可能是项目成功的关键,这些需求应被放在优先级较高的位置。而一些优化性需求、非核心功能则可以放在较低优先级,待核心功能开发完成后再进行实现。

三、使用有效的沟通工具

在需求收集的过程中,使用有效的沟通工具是确保信息准确传递和记录的重要手段。像PingCodeWorktile这样的需求管理工具,能够帮助团队更好地管理和跟踪需求,确保所有需求都能得到及时的反馈和处理。【PingCode官网】【Worktile官网

例如,在使用PingCode时,团队可以通过创建需求卡片,将每个需求的详细信息记录下来,并分配给相关的团队成员进行处理。同时,需求的状态、优先级等信息也可以在工具中进行更新和跟踪,使得整个需求管理过程更加清晰和高效。

四、创建需求管理文档

需求管理文档是需求收集和管理的重要工具。通过创建详细的需求管理文档,团队可以清楚地记录和追踪每个需求的状态、优先级、实现进度等信息。这不仅有助于团队内部的沟通和协调,也能帮助客户更好地了解项目的进展情况。

需求管理文档应包括以下内容:

  1. 需求编号:每个需求都应有唯一的编号,方便后续的跟踪和管理。
  2. 需求描述:详细描述需求的内容、背景和预期效果。
  3. 需求来源:记录提出需求的客户或团队成员信息。
  4. 需求优先级:根据需求的重要性和紧急程度进行分类。
  5. 需求状态:记录需求的当前状态,如待处理、处理中、已完成等。
  6. 实现进度:跟踪需求的实现进度和时间节点。

通过创建和维护需求管理文档,团队可以更好地掌握项目的整体情况,确保每个需求都能得到及时的处理和反馈。

五、定期更新需求状态

在需求收集和实现的过程中,定期更新需求状态是确保项目顺利进行的重要环节。需求的状态更新不仅可以帮助团队成员了解当前的工作进展,还能及时发现和解决问题,避免项目进度受到影响。

例如,团队可以每周召开一次需求状态更新会议,检查每个需求的实现进度和当前状态。对于已经完成的需求,应及时进行验收和确认;对于正在进行中的需求,应检查是否存在困难和问题,并及时提供支持和解决方案;对于尚未开始的需求,应根据优先级和资源情况合理安排实施计划。

通过定期更新需求状态,团队可以保持对项目的整体掌控,确保每个需求都能按计划顺利进行。

六、需求变更管理

在需求收集中,需求变更是不可避免的。为了有效管理需求变更,团队需要制定明确的变更管理流程和规范。变更管理流程应包括变更的提出、评估、审批、实施和反馈等环节,确保每个变更都能得到充分的考虑和处理。

例如,当客户提出新的需求或对已有需求进行修改时,团队应首先进行评估,确定变更的影响范围和优先级。然后,根据评估结果进行审批,决定是否接受变更。对于接受的变更,应及时更新需求管理文档和需求状态,确保所有团队成员都能了解和掌握最新的需求情况。

通过有效的需求变更管理,团队可以更好地应对项目中的变化,确保项目的顺利进行和最终成功。

七、需求验证和确认

在需求收集的最后阶段,需求验证和确认是确保需求准确和可行的重要环节。需求验证是指检查需求的完整性和一致性,确保所有需求都能得到充分的描述和理解;需求确认是指与客户或相关方进行沟通,确认需求的准确性和可行性。

例如,在需求验证过程中,团队可以通过需求评审会议,检查每个需求的详细信息和描述,确保所有需求都能得到充分的理解和记录。在需求确认过程中,团队可以与客户进行沟通,确认需求的准确性和优先级,确保所有需求都能得到客户的认可和支持。

通过需求验证和确认,团队可以更好地掌握项目的需求情况,确保每个需求都能得到准确和可行的处理。

八、使用需求管理工具

有效的需求管理工具可以帮助团队更好地收集、管理和跟踪需求。PingCode和Worktile是两款非常优秀的需求管理工具,能够满足不同项目和团队的需求。

例如,PingCode提供了丰富的需求管理功能,包括需求卡片、需求状态跟踪、需求优先级管理等,帮助团队更好地管理和跟踪需求。同时,PingCode还支持多种沟通方式,如评论、通知等,使得团队成员可以随时进行沟通和协作。【PingCode官网】

Worktile则是一款通用型的项目管理系统,提供了需求管理、任务管理、时间管理等多种功能,帮助团队更好地进行项目管理和需求管理。通过使用Worktile,团队可以更好地掌握项目的整体情况,确保每个需求都能得到及时的处理和反馈。【Worktile官网】

通过使用需求管理工具,团队可以更好地收集、管理和跟踪需求,确保项目的顺利进行和最终成功。

九、定期回顾和总结

在需求收集的过程中,定期回顾和总结是确保需求管理效果的重要环节。通过定期回顾和总结,团队可以发现和解决问题,优化需求管理流程,提高项目的成功率。

例如,团队可以每月或每季度召开一次需求回顾会议,检查和总结需求管理的效果。对于已经完成的需求,应总结成功经验和不足之处;对于正在进行中的需求,应检查是否存在问题和困难,并及时提供支持和解决方案;对于尚未开始的需求,应根据优先级和资源情况合理安排实施计划。

通过定期回顾和总结,团队可以不断优化需求管理流程,提高项目的成功率和客户满意度。

十、培训和指导

在需求收集的过程中,培训和指导是确保团队成员能够有效进行需求收集和管理的重要环节。通过培训和指导,团队成员可以掌握需求收集和管理的基本知识和技能,提高需求管理的效果。

例如,团队可以定期组织需求管理培训,讲解需求收集和管理的基本知识和技能,如需求记录、需求优先级管理、需求状态跟踪等。同时,团队还可以通过指导和支持,帮助成员解决需求管理中遇到的问题和困难,提高需求管理的效果。

通过培训和指导,团队成员可以更好地掌握需求收集和管理的基本知识和技能,提高项目的成功率和客户满意度。

十一、沟通和协作

在需求收集的过程中,沟通和协作是确保需求准确和可行的重要环节。通过有效的沟通和协作,团队成员可以更好地理解和实施需求,提高项目的成功率。

例如,团队可以通过定期召开需求沟通会议,讨论和确认需求的详细信息和优先级。通过有效的沟通,团队成员可以更好地理解客户的需求和期望,确保需求的准确和可行。同时,团队还可以通过协作工具,如PingCode和Worktile,进行需求的记录、跟踪和管理,提高需求管理的效果。【PingCode官网】【Worktile官网】

通过有效的沟通和协作,团队可以更好地理解和实施需求,提高项目的成功率和客户满意度。

十二、客户参与

在需求收集的过程中,客户参与是确保需求准确和可行的重要环节。通过客户的参与,团队可以更好地理解客户的需求和期望,提高项目的成功率。

例如,团队可以通过定期与客户沟通,了解客户的需求和期望。通过客户的参与,团队可以更好地理解需求的详细信息和优先级,确保需求的准确和可行。同时,团队还可以通过客户反馈,及时发现和解决问题,提高需求管理的效果。

通过客户的参与,团队可以更好地理解客户的需求和期望,提高项目的成功率和客户满意度。

十三、需求跟踪和反馈

在需求收集的过程中,需求跟踪和反馈是确保需求准确和可行的重要环节。通过需求跟踪和反馈,团队可以更好地掌握需求的状态和进展情况,确保需求的及时处理和反馈。

例如,团队可以通过需求管理工具,如PingCode和Worktile,进行需求的记录、跟踪和反馈。通过需求管理工具,团队可以实时了解需求的状态和进展情况,确保需求的及时处理和反馈。同时,团队还可以通过需求管理工具,进行需求的优先级管理和状态跟踪,提高需求管理的效果。【PingCode官网】【Worktile官网】

通过需求跟踪和反馈,团队可以更好地掌握需求的状态和进展情况,确保需求的及时处理和反馈,提高项目的成功率和客户满意度。

十四、需求文档管理

在需求收集的过程中,需求文档管理是确保需求准确和可行的重要环节。通过需求文档管理,团队可以更好地记录和跟踪需求,确保需求的及时处理和反馈。

例如,团队可以通过需求管理工具,如PingCode和Worktile,进行需求文档的记录和管理。通过需求管理工具,团队可以实时更新和维护需求文档,确保需求的及时处理和反馈。同时,团队还可以通过需求文档管理,进行需求的优先级管理和状态跟踪,提高需求管理的效果。【PingCode官网】【Worktile官网】

通过需求文档管理,团队可以更好地记录和跟踪需求,确保需求的及时处理和反馈,提高项目的成功率和客户满意度。

十五、需求变更控制

在需求收集的过程中,需求变更控制是确保需求准确和可行的重要环节。通过需求变更控制,团队可以更好地管理和处理需求变更,确保项目的顺利进行。

例如,团队可以通过需求变更控制流程,进行需求变更的评估、审批和实施。通过需求变更控制流程,团队可以及时发现和解决需求变更问题,确保需求变更的准确和可行。同时,团队还可以通过需求管理工具,如PingCode和Worktile,进行需求变更的记录和跟踪,提高需求变更管理的效果。【PingCode官网】【Worktile官网】

通过需求变更控制,团队可以更好地管理和处理需求变更,确保项目的顺利进行,提高项目的成功率和客户满意度。

十六、需求管理流程优化

在需求收集的过程中,需求管理流程优化是确保需求准确和可行的重要环节。通过需求管理流程优化,团队可以不断优化和改进需求管理流程,提高需求管理的效果。

例如,团队可以通过定期回顾和总结需求管理流程,发现和解决问题,优化需求管理流程。通过需求管理流程优化,团队可以不断提高需求管理的效果,确保需求的及时处理和反馈。同时,团队还可以通过需求管理工具,如PingCode和Worktile,进行需求管理流程的优化和改进,提高需求管理的效果。【PingCode官网】【Worktile官网】

通过需求管理流程优化,团队可以不断优化和改进需求管理流程,提高需求管理的效果,提高项目的成功率和客户满意度。

十七、需求管理的持续改进

在需求收集的过程中,需求管理的持续改进是确保需求准确和可行的重要环节。通过需求管理的持续改进,团队可以不断提高需求管理的效果,确保项目的顺利进行。

例如,团队可以通过定期回顾和总结需求管理的效果,发现和解决问题,持续改进需求管理。通过需求管理的持续改进,团队可以不断提高需求管理的效果,确保需求的及时处理和反馈。同时,团队还可以通过需求管理工具,如PingCode和Worktile,进行需求管理的持续改进,提高需求管理的效果。【PingCode官网】【Worktile官网】

通过需求管理的持续改进,团队可以不断提高需求管理的效果,确保项目的顺利进行,提高项目的成功率和客户满意度。

十八、需求管理的标准化

在需求收集的过程中,需求管理的标准化是确保需求准确和可行的重要环节。通过需求管理的标准化,团队可以更好地管理和处理需求,确保项目的顺利进行。

例如,团队可以通过制定需求管理标准和规范,进行需求管理的标准化。通过需求管理的标准化,团队可以更好地管理和处理需求,确保需求的准确和可行。同时,团队还可以通过需求管理工具,如PingCode和Worktile,进行需求管理的标准化,提高需求管理的效果。【PingCode官网】【Worktile官网】

通过需求管理的标准化,团队可以更好地管理和处理需求,确保项目的顺利进行,提高项目的成功率和客户满意度。

十九、需求管理的风险控制

在需求收集的过程中,需求管理的风险控制是确保需求准确和可行的重要环节。通过需求管理的风险控制,团队可以更好地识别和控制需求管理中的风险,确保项目的顺利进行。

例如,团队可以通过需求管理的风险评估和控制,进行需求管理的风险控制。通过需求管理的风险控制,团队可以及时发现和解决需求管理中的风险,确保需求的准确和可行。同时,团队还可以通过需求管理工具,如PingCode和Worktile,进行需求管理的风险控制,提高需求管理的效果。【PingCode官网】【Worktile官网】

通过需求管理的风险控制,团队可以更好地识别和控制需求管理中的风险,确保项目的顺利进行,提高项目的成功率和客户满意度。

二十、需求管理的效果评估

在需求收集的过程中,需求管理的效果评估是确保需求准确和可行的重要环节。通过需求管理的效果评估,团队可以不断提高需求管理的效果,确保项目的顺利进行。

例如,团队可以通过需求管理的效果评估,发现和解决需求管理中的问题,提高需求管理的效果。通过需求管理的效果评估,团队可以不断优化和改进需求管理流程,提高需求管理的效果。同时,团队还可以通过需求管理工具,如PingCode和Worktile,进行需求管理的效果评估,提高需求管理的效果。【PingCode官网】【Worktile官网】

通过需求管理的效果评估,团队可以不断提高需求管理的效果,确保项目的顺利进行,提高项目的成功率和客户满意度。


通过上述详细的需求收集和管理步骤,团队可以更好地收集、管理和跟踪需求,确保项目的顺利进行和最终成功。希望这些方法和工具能对您有所帮助。

相关问答FAQs:

1. 为什么需求收集对项目成功至关重要?
需求收集是项目中最关键的一步,它确保项目团队和客户之间的沟通顺畅,减少项目失败的风险。通过充分了解客户需求,团队能够更好地规划、设计和实施项目,从而提供符合客户期望的最终产品。

2. 如何有效地进行需求收集?
需求收集需要一定的技巧和方法。首先,团队应该与客户进行密切的合作,倾听他们的意见和建议。其次,可以通过组织会议、面对面访谈、问卷调查等方式来收集客户需求。此外,使用一些工具和技术,如敏捷开发方法、原型设计等,可以更好地捕捉和理解客户需求。

3. 需求收集中可能会遇到的挑战有哪些?
在需求收集过程中,团队可能会面临一些挑战。首先,客户需求可能不够明确或者矛盾,需要团队和客户共同澄清和解决。其次,需求可能会随着项目的进行发生变化,需要灵活地进行调整和管理。此外,团队成员之间的沟通和协作也是一个重要的挑战,需要建立良好的团队合作氛围。

原创文章,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/5183522

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部